Revenue and income statement
In 2024, CARRIERES DE CLUIS achieves revenue of 6.1 M€. Revenue is growing positively over 9 years (CAGR: +4.9%). Vs 2023, growth of +21% (5.0 M€ -> 6.1 M€). After deducting consumption (881 k€), gross margin stands at 5.2 M€, i.e. a rate of 86%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 1.2 M€, representing 20.0% of revenue. Positive scissor effect: EBITDA margin improves by +10.0 pts, sign of improved operational efficiency. This high EBITDA margin provides strong self-financing capacity and resilience to uncertainties.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 469 k€, i.e. 7.7%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 166%. Critical situation: debt significantly exceeds equity, severely limiting borrowing capacity and exposing the company to default risk.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 25%. The balance between equity and debt is satisfactory. Debt repayment capacity (= Financial debt / Cash flow) indicates it would take 3.1 years of cash flow to repay all financial debt. This ratio remains within usual banking standards. Cash flow represents 12.9%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ment. This high level provides strong self-financing capacity.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 31 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 63 days. Excellent situation: suppliers finance 32 days of the operating cycle (retail model). Inventory turnover is 176 days (= Average inventory / Cost of goods x 360). This high level ties up cash and potentially creates obsolescence risk. Overall, WCR represents 187 days of revenue, i.e. 3.2 M€ to permanently finance. Over 2016-2024, WCR increased by +320%, requiring additional financing.
